package swarm
import (
"bytes"
"fmt"
"io/ioutil"
"strings"
"testing"
"github.com/docker/docker/api/types"
"github.com/docker/docker/api/types/swarm"
"github.com/docker/docker/cli/internal/test"
"github.com/docker/docker/pkg/testutil/assert"
)
func TestSwarmJoinErrors(t *testing.T) {
testCases := []struct {
name string
args []string
swarmJoinFunc func() error
infoFunc func() (types.Info, error)
expectedError string
}{
{
name: "not-enough-args",
expectedError: "requires exactly 1 argument",
},
{
name: "too-many-args",
args: []string{"remote1", "remote2"},
expectedError: "requires exactly 1 argument",
},
{
name: "join-failed",
args: []string{"remote"},
swarmJoinFunc: func() error {
return fmt.Errorf("error joining the swarm")
},
expectedError: "error joining the swarm",
},
{
name: "join-failed-on-init",
args: []string{"remote"},
infoFunc: func() (types.Info, error) {
return types.Info{}, fmt.Errorf("error asking for node info")
},
expectedError: "error asking for node info",
},
}
for _, tc := range testCases {
buf := new(bytes.Buffer)
cmd := newJoinCommand(
test.NewFakeCli(&fakeClient{
swarmJoinFunc: tc.swarmJoinFunc,
infoFunc: tc.infoFunc,
}, buf))
cmd.SetArgs(tc.args)
cmd.SetOutput(ioutil.Discard)
assert.Error(t, cmd.Execute(), tc.expectedError)
}
}
func TestSwarmJoin(t *testing.T) {
testCases := []struct {
name string
infoFunc func() (types.Info, error)
expected string
}{
{
name: "join-as-manager",
infoFunc: func() (types.Info, error) {
return types.Info{
Swarm: swarm.Info{
ControlAvailable: true,
},
}, nil
},
expected: "This node joined a swarm as a manager.",
},
{
name: "join-as-worker",
infoFunc: func() (types.Info, error) {
return types.Info{
Swarm: swarm.Info{
ControlAvailable: false,
},
}, nil
},
expected: "This node joined a swarm as a worker.",
},
}
for _, tc := range testCases {
buf := new(bytes.Buffer)
cmd := newJoinCommand(
test.NewFakeCli(&fakeClient{
infoFunc: tc.infoFunc,
}, buf))
cmd.SetArgs([]string{"remote"})
assert.NilError(t, cmd.Execute())
assert.Equal(t, strings.TrimSpace(buf.String()), tc.expected)
}
}
